## ChipGate Reader Basics

The ChipGate reader at Larkspur races logs every mat crossing to the Splitline ingest queue. Dedup happens downstream; the reader itself is dumb on purpose. If crossings stop appearing, check antenna power first, then the uplink LED. Firmware flashes only happen between race weekends. Calibration steps, wiring diagrams, and the failure runbook are all on the internal page below.

operations page: https://jenkins.zemvarcloud.local/job/merge_requests/repo/build/73930b4b30f0a8ed

## Capacity note: Trellis component library versioning

Quick heads-up: every minor release of Trellis fans out rebuilds across ~40 consumer apps, and our CI pool feels it. We're capping concurrent downstream builds and batching version bumps so a chatty release week doesn't starve everyone else. Reviewers: if you touch the release pipeline, keep the fan-out math in mind — it's quadratic-ish during migration windows. Current limits are pinned to these constants.

limits module of yadug-tawip:
QUOTAS = {
    "julael": 705,
    "kasael": 903,
    "druwyn": 489,
}

## Build Provenance: Fanout Backpressure Patch (Larkspire Notify)

Reviewers: the backpressure change caps per-subscriber queue depth and sheds oldest-first when the fan-out worker falls behind. Verify the shed counter is exported before approving, since ops alerts depend on it. Provenance for this change is reproducible from a clean checkout, and the attestation pipeline pins it to the trace token recorded below.

pipeline stamp: htk9_ce63042d9

## Authentication

Nightjar (the backfill scheduler) requires a bearer token for every API call. Tokens are scoped per environment — never reuse a dev token against prod.

To enqueue or inspect a backfill job, set the `Authorization` header on your request. Tokens rotate weekly; the scheduler rejects anything older.

For local testing against the sandbox instance, use the token below.

login token, bagug-kafop: eyJhbGciOiJIUzI1NiIsInR5cCI6IkpXVCJ9.eyJzdWIiOiIcMLov2In0.Z5RLDIfp